DC reviews functioning of Tehsil Office, B’gam, Inspects infra upgradation works of Tehsil, DSEO Complex

Budgam: The Deputy Commissioner (DC) Budgam, Akshay Labroo, on Tuesday reviewed the functioning of Tehsil Office, Budgam and took an overview of the various revenue services being provided by the Office of the Tehsildar, Budgam.
DC also inspected the revenue record room, and emphasised its further streamlining and convert it into a model record room.
Labroo also conducted an on site inspection of two major infrastructure upgradation projects in the district – the Tehsil Office Budgam and the Office complex of the District Statistics & Evaluation Office (DSEO), Budgam.
During the inspection of Tehsil office Budgam, the DC emphasised timely execution and maintenance of quality standards of work.
He directed the concerned departments to closely monitor progress and ensure the projects are completed within the stipulated timeframes.
Later, the DC also took stock of upgradation work on Office complex of the District Statistics & Evaluation Office, Budgam where he directed the officials and executing agency to adhere strictly to the set deadlines.
On the occasion, the DC stated that both the projects are important for enhancing administrative efficiency and delivering better services to the local population of Budgam.
He said, district administration is committed towards improving public infrastructure and ensuring better service delivery in Budgam.
